AI systems capable of sophisticated hacking are on track to become standard rather than exceptional, according to Ars Technica.

In a piece titled "'Dangerous' AI models are coming no matter what," the outlet reports that AI models with advanced hacking capabilities will soon be the norm. The framing matters: the headline's "no matter what" suggests these capabilities are arriving as an expected feature of the technology's progress, not as a rare or easily contained outlier.

What does that mean in practice? As AI models grow more capable across the board, the same skills that let them write and analyze code can extend to finding and exploiting security weaknesses. Ars Technica's reporting indicates this is becoming a common property of advanced models rather than a niche concern limited to a handful of specialized tools.

The distinction between defensive and offensive uses blurs as these capabilities become widespread. The same model that helps a security team probe its own systems for flaws could, in other hands, be turned toward attacking them.

Why it matters: if advanced hacking ability becomes a routine feature of widely available AI, then defenders, companies, and policymakers can no longer treat such capability as a distant or avoidable risk — they have to plan for a world where it is simply part of the landscape.
